"He that augmenteth his substance by interest and increase, Gathereth it for him that hath pity on the poor." — Proverbs 28:8 (ASV)
Unjust gain - Omit “unjust”: “usury and gain” form the concept of “gain derived from usury.” Ill-gotten gains do not prosper; after a time, they pass into hands that know how to use them better.
